Output d5f23e26f1e62fb6c675fc0d230d5d36e1f13b45d6381c72fd71ac715aacf4bb:3

value
2009976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ccd7ae0259fb240605d42f48a4f3e49970f304 OP_EQUAL
address
3FSNg2PCgnJSzyV7KJwYzScx4yeLJ9Mm1Y
transaction
d5f23e26f1e62fb6c675fc0d230d5d36e1f13b45d6381c72fd71ac715aacf4bb
spent
true